Design and Aesthetics: Does It Look Sporty?
The exterior design of the 2024 Santa Fe is definitely a departure from previous models. It features a more aggressive front fascia with a bold grille, distinctive T-shaped LED daytime running lights, and sharp lines that give it a modern, almost futuristic look. The overall silhouette is more upright and boxy, which some might find appealing, while others might miss the sleeker curves of the older models.
Inside, the Santa Fe boasts a premium cabin with high-quality materials and a well-thought-out layout. The dashboard is dominated by a large touchscreen display, and the overall design is clean and minimalist. While it's certainly a comfortable and stylish interior, it doesn't necessarily scream sports car.
Engine and Performance: How Does It Drive?
Here's where things get interesting. The 2024 Santa Fe offers a few different engine options, including a hybrid and a plug-in hybrid. But if we're talking about sporty, we need to focus on the gasoline engines. The standard engine is a 2.5-liter four-cylinder, while the upgraded option is a turbocharged version of the same engine. This turbo engine definitely packs more punch, delivering strong acceleration and a more engaging driving experience.
The handling is decent, with the Santa Fe feeling stable and composed on the road. However, it's not exactly a sports car when it comes to cornering. There's some body roll, and the steering isn't the most communicative. But overall, it's a comfortable and capable SUV that can handle most driving situations with ease.
Technology and Features: Enhancing the Experience
The 2024 Santa Fe is packed with tech features that enhance both the driving experience and overall convenience. The large touchscreen display is easy to use and integrates seamlessly with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. There's also a digital instrument cluster that provides important information in a clear and concise manner. Other notable tech features include a premium sound system, a panoramic sunroof, and a wireless charging pad.
